SPARK is an international development organisation with more than 28 years of experience in supporting entrepreneurship development in fragile states. Soon we will start implementing a new programme to support entrepreneurship development and MSMEs growth in the Benghazi region.

We are looking for a results-oriented and experienced Finance Manager. He/she will be responsible for sound internal and external financial reporting and compliance with (donor) policies. The position offers a great opportunity to be deeply involved in business development, entrepreneurship and (youth) job creation in conflict affected environments.

Main Tasks and Responsibilities:

The responsibilities and tasks include, but are not limited to:

  • Execute and exercise financial management in line with SPARK systems and procedures;
  • With support of the grant officer, manage an efficient and cost effective financial bookkeeping;
  • Ensures SPARK and donor requirements are met on finance, control and procurement and facilitate accurate and timely reporting to donors;
  • Maintain good financial control for implementing partner (IP) management and where needed build capacity of partners;
  • In coordination with the regional and central finance team, manage all (external) audit processes.
  • Prepare monthly wire transfer requests and regular expenditure forecasts for budget monitoring purposes;
  • Prepare budget adjustment notifications and addendums in cooperation with the program manager/team leader and regional Finance Manager
  • Process payments (cash and bank) and make sure all accounting records, including invoices, bank documents, cash receipts and cash disbursement journals are accurate
  • Deal with Grants financial issues, including the preparation and/or verification of contracts along with the Grants officer;
  • Ensure that the country financials meet all donor requirements, Libyan financial requirements, EU bookkeeping requirements as well as SPARK internal regulations;
  • Act as people manager to and work closely with the grants officer.

Requirements and Skills

  • Approximately 7 + years of experience in comparable functions in field of finance management;
  • A degree, preferred a Master’s, in the field of financial management and/or control;
  • Preferably experience in an international non-profit organization;
  • Preferably experience in administering EU funds;
  • Fluency in spoken and written English (Dutch and Arabic are an extra asset);
  • Willingness and possibility to travel several times a year;
  • Develop and show an attitude of continuous learning and willingness to share this with the organisation;
  • Reliable, flexible, and problem solving person.

About SPARK

SPARK develops higher education and entrepreneurship, so that young ambitious people are empowered to lead their conflict-affected society into prosperity. SPARK is a dynamic and growing not-for-profit development organization with 100+ staff members, which supports young entrepreneurs to start or grow their own businesses. SPARK provides displaced youth and women with access to higher education in fragile areas. SPARK specifically focuses its intervention on localization through building the capacities of local partners and stakeholders, green entrepreneurship, digitalization, and women entrepreneurship.
